Fiberlogy R PLA is a response to the growing ecological and environmental needs of 3D printing users. This innovative filament is made from 100% recycled material sourced exclusively from verified and carefully selected origins. As a result, Fiberlogy R PLA combines high print quality—comparable to standard PLA filaments—with care for the natural environment.

The production of the filament is strictly controlled at every stage—from material sourcing, through storage, to the final product delivered to customers’ 3D printers. This approach ensures consistent properties and safe, reliable printing.

It is worth noting that, due to natural variations in the raw material, Fiberlogy R PLA may vary in color and contain trace amounts of glitter, which highlights its authentic recycled origin. The availability of the material depends on the supply of recycled resources, making production fully aligned with the principles of sustainable development.

Fiberlogy R PLA is an excellent choice for 3D printing users who want to combine quality with environmental responsibility and support eco-friendly innovations in additive manufacturing.

Recommendations and tips

Print settings

  • Printing temperature 210-230°C
  • Bed temperature 60°C
  • Build surface Smooth PEI, Textured PEI, Glass
  • Drying conditions 50°C / 4h
  • Enclosure not required
  • Cooling fan 75-100%

Properties

  • Density 1.24 g/cm³
  • Tensile Strength @ Yield 60 MPa (ASTM D882)
  • Tensile Strength @ Break 53 MPa (ASTM D882)
  • Tensile Modulus 3500 MPa (ASTM D882)
  • Elongation @ Yield 6% (ASTM D882)
  • Flexular Strength 81 MPa (ASTM D790)
  • Flexular Modulus 3800 MPa (ASTM D790)
  • Izod Impact Strength (Notched) @ 23℃ 16 J/m (ASTM D256)
  • Heat Distortion Temperature @ 0.45 MPa 55°C (ASTM E2092)
  • Glass Transition Temperature 55 - 60°C (DSC)

Why not HEX?

Providing the color of 3D printing filament in HEX format does not make sense because this notation was created to describe colors displayed on screens (RGB – monitors, TVs, mobile devices). HEX defines a mix of red, green and blue light, meaning a digital color. With filaments, however, we deal with a physical material. The same filament may look different in various photos and HEX cannot accurately represent the actual appearance of the material.

Much better references are color systems used in printing and industry, such as RAL or Pantone, which are based on real samples and allow for comparison of colors in physical reality.
